第3 章磁 盘 管 理 Windows Server 2012 在存储方面带来了大量的变化,微软交付的解决方案是一种全新 的方式,来管理我们的磁盘和存储。其中包括SMB 3.0,它开启了一些令人兴奋的新的可 能性。不过,最大的变化,还在于为布局和配置存储本身。引进的存储空间带来了它提供 集群的能力,可以提供高可用性和集成的群集共享卷,为虚拟机、文件共享和其他工作负 载的可扩展性部署。 文件和存储服务是Windows Server 2012 的18 个角色之一,只需要安装即可。服务器 可以是完整的GUI 或者Server Core 版本。存储子系统通过GUI 或通过PowerShell 命令在 本地远程控制。“存储池”显示了在本地服务器上创建的或访问远程服务器上的各个存储空 间。“原始”空间是指任何添加到服务器中,但尚未加入存储空间的物理磁盘。添加一个磁 盘会清除它的所有数据。 整个存储池的屏幕上,显示的是存储空间和构成的物理磁盘,以及任何已创建的虚拟 磁盘的详细信息。 3.1 磁 盘 类 型 磁盘的使用方式可以分为两种类型:一种是基本磁盘,另一种磁盘类型是动态磁盘。 基本磁盘非常常见,我们平时使用的磁盘类型基本上都是基本磁盘。基本磁盘受26 个英 文字母的限制,也就是说磁盘的盘符只能是26 个英文字母中的一个。因为A、B 已经被软 驱占用,实际上磁盘可用的盘符只有C~Z,共24 个。另外,在基本磁盘上只能建立四个 主分区(注意是主分区,而不是扩展分区)。动态磁盘不受26 个英文字母的限制,它是用 “卷”来命名的。动态磁盘的最大优点是可以将磁盘容量扩展到非邻近的磁盘空间。 无论是基本磁盘还是动态磁盘,都可以使用任何文件系统,包括FAT 和NTFS。而且 我们可以在动态磁盘改变卷而不需要重启系统。我们可以把一个基本磁盘转换成动态磁盘。 但是这并不是一个双向的过程。一旦把基本磁盘变成了动态磁盘,除非重新创建卷,否则 不能将它转变回去。 在对磁盘进行管理之前,先添加几块磁盘。 实验案例:磁盘的添加。 第一步,在主窗口中选择“虚拟机”下的“设置”,然后选择“硬件”选项卡下的 “硬盘”,再单击下方的“添加”按钮,进入添加硬件向导,首先选择“硬盘”,再单击 “下一步”按钮,选择虚拟磁盘类型,再单击“下一步”选择磁盘,下一步再设置磁盘大 小,下一步指定磁盘文件的路径和名称,最后单击“完成”按钮。如图3.1~图3.4 所示。 Windows Server 2012 系统管理与网络服务配置 50 图 3.1 图 3.2 第 章 磁盘管理 51 3 图 3.3 图 3.4 磁盘管理 Windows Server 2012 系统管理与网络服务配置 52 照此步骤再重复两次,即可创建三个磁盘,如图3.5 所示。 图 3.5 3.2 基本磁盘的管理 基本磁盘的磁盘分为主分区和扩展分区。主分区可以用来启动操作系统,而扩展分区 只能用来保存文件,不能用来启动操作系统。磁盘分为MBR 和GPT 两种分区样式,MBR 是旧的传统样式,支持的硬盘最大为2.2TB;而GPT 是新样式,可以提供排错功能,支持 的硬盘可以超过2.2TB。MBR 磁盘可以有四个主分区或三个主分区和一个扩展分区,扩展 分区可以包含无数个逻辑驱动器。基本磁盘上的分区不能与其他分区共享或拆分数据。 Windows 系统的一个GPT 磁盘内可以创建128 个主要分区,因为分区数足够多,所以 不需要扩展分区,旧版的Windows 系统(如Windows 2000 等)无法识别GPT 磁盘。 1.创建主分区 在一个基本磁盘上创建主分区的步骤如下: (1)联机 在服务器管理器窗口,选择“文件和存储服务”,再单击“磁盘”按钮,可以看到当 前有4 个磁盘,其中磁盘0 是联机状态,其他三个都是脱机,选中磁盘1,右击,在弹出 第 章 磁盘管理 53 3 的快捷菜单中选择“联机”选项,可以看到其状态发生了改变。要想对磁盘进行管理,必 须先改为联机状态,如图3.6 所示。 图 3.6 (2)初始化 选中磁盘1,右击,在弹出的快捷菜单中选择“初始化”选项,弹出是否继续对话框, 选择“是”按钮,磁盘被初始化为GPT 磁盘形式,如图3.7 所示。一般主启动记录采用 MBR 形式,而非主启动记录所在的磁盘采用GPT 形式。 图 3.7 (3)新建卷 选中“磁盘1”,右击,在弹出的快捷菜单中选择“新建卷”选项,进入下一步,在 “新建卷向导”窗口中选择“磁盘1”,如图3.8 所示,再单击“下一步”按钮设置卷的大 Windows Server 2012 系统管理与网络服务配置 54 小,设置分配的驱动器号,再单击“下一步”按钮,设置文件系统后再单击“下一步”按 钮。确认无误后再单击“创建”按钮就完成了卷的创建,如图3.9 所示。 图 3.8 图 3.9 第 章 磁盘管理 55 3 此时看到,磁盘1 未分配空间变为49.9GB,左下方“卷”下面可以看到刚新建的卷E, 容量为10GB,如图3.10 所示。 图 3.10 按此方法我们在磁盘1 上再建立F、G 和H 三个卷。它们都是主分区,如图3.11 所示。 图 3.11 Windows Server 2012 系统管理与网络服务配置 56 2.创建扩展分区 如果在一个磁盘上已经创建了三个主分区,剩余的所有空间作为扩展分区可以创建多 个逻辑分区。如图3.11 所示,在磁盘0 上,前三个是主分区,包括安装系统时被划分的系 统保留区(350MB)、C 驱(40.13GB)和刚创建的I 驱,后面的J、K 和L 是逻辑分区。 3.扩展基本卷 扩展基本卷就是将未分配的空间,合并到已建立的基本卷内,以扩大其容量。如磁盘 1 的H 卷目前为8GB,现在我们来扩大2GB。 首先,选中“卷H”并右击,在弹出的快捷菜单中选择“扩展卷”选项,在“扩展卷 向导”中单击“下一步”按钮,选择要扩展的磁盘“磁盘1”,如图3.12 所示,并设置要扩 展的容量2048MB,再单击“下一步”选项,然后完成,如图3.13 所示。 图 3.12 图 3.13 第 章 磁盘管理 57 3 完成后可以看到H 卷的容量变成了10GB,如图3.14 所示。 图 3.14 4.压缩卷 比如H 卷实际容量为10GB,若实际使用量一般不超过5GB,则可以将未使用的空间 腾一部分出来,例如现在要压缩3GB 出来,可以这样设置:首先,选中磁盘H 并右击,在 弹出的快捷菜单中选择“压缩卷”选项,在“压缩H:”对话框中的“输入压缩空间量” 为3072,再单击“压缩”按钮,然后完成压缩,如图3.15 所示。 图 3.15 完成后我们会发现,H 卷的容量变为7GB,而未分配空间由26.87GB 变为29.87GB, 如图3.16 所示。 Windows Server 2012 系统管理与网络服务配置 58 图 3.16 3.3 动态磁盘的管理 动态磁盘支持多种类型的动态卷,包括简单卷、跨区卷、带区卷、镜像卷和RAID-5 卷。在配置动态磁盘之前,需要将基本磁盘转换为动态磁盘。 方法是:右击要转换的磁盘(如磁盘1),在弹出的快捷菜单中选择“转换为动态磁 盘”选项,勾选要转换的磁盘,单击“确定”按钮,如图3.17 所示。 图 3.17 再选择“磁盘1”,单击“转换”按钮,再确定继续单击“是”按钮,如图3.18 所示。 此时发现磁盘1 的类型由“基本”变为“动态”,另外,转换之前E、F、G 和H 四个 卷是基本卷,转换后变为简单卷(卷的颜色由深蓝变为黄绿色),如图3.19 所示。 第 章 磁盘管理 59 3 图 3.18 图 3.19 3.3.1 简单卷 简单卷是动态卷中的基本单位,与基本磁盘的分区较相似,但是它没有空间的限制以 及数量的限制。当简单卷的空间不够用时,也可以通过扩展卷来扩充其空间,而这丝毫不 Windows Server 2012 系统管理与网络服务配置 60 会影响其中的数据。 简单卷的创建方法和前面基本卷的创建方法类似,也可以扩展和压缩,更改驱动器 号等。 例如我们用磁盘2,新建一个简单卷M,大小为2GB,如图3.20 所示。 图 3.20 如果觉得该卷容量太小,可以再扩展,如图3.21 所示。扩展时可以选择“磁盘2”,并 设置选择空间量1024MB,完成后,发现卷M 的容量变为3072MB。 图 3.21 简单卷的扩展只能在同一块磁盘上进行。如果在扩展时,选择的是在磁盘3 上增加 1024MB,则卷M 的类型发生了变化,即变为了跨区卷,如图3.22 所示。 第 章 磁盘管理 61 3 图 3.22 3.3.2 跨区卷 跨区卷是一个包含多块磁盘上的空间的卷(最多32 块),向跨区卷中存储数据信息的 顺序是存满第一块磁盘再逐渐向后面的磁盘中存储。通过创建跨区卷,我们可以将多块物 理磁盘中的空余空间分配成同一个卷,可以有效利用资源,每块磁盘容量可以不同。但是, 跨区卷并不能提高性能,也没有容错功能。 我们在磁盘2 上建立跨区卷,然后设置在磁盘2 上使用2048MB,在磁盘3 上使用 3072MB,如图3.23 所示。 图 3.23 Windows Server 2012 系统管理与网络服务配置 62 最后创建的跨区卷N 容量为5G,如图3.24 所示。 图 3.24 3.3.3 带区卷 带区卷是由两个或多个磁盘中的空余空间组成的卷(最多32 块磁盘),与跨区卷不同 的是,每块磁盘分配的容量大小必须相同,在向带区卷中写入数据时,数据被分割成64KB 的数据块,然后同时向阵列中的每一块磁盘写入不同的数据块。这个过程显著提高了磁盘 效率和性能,但是,带区卷也不提供容错性。 在磁盘2 的未分配区右击,选择新建带区卷,将磁盘3 从“可用”框添加进“已选的” 框,然后设置选择空间量为2048MB(注意这里不能分别为每块磁盘设置不同的容量),再 下一步,如图3.25 所示。 最后创建好带区卷O,容量为4GB,如图3.26 所示。 3.3.4 镜像卷 我们可以很简单地解释镜像卷为一个带有一份完全相同的副本的简单卷,它需要两 块磁盘,一块存储运作中的数据,一块存储完全一样的那份副本,当一块磁盘失败时, 另一块磁盘可以立即使用,避免了数据丢失。镜像卷提供了容错性,但是它不提供性能 的优化。 第 章 磁盘管理 63 3 图 3.25 图 3.26 如图3.27 所示,只能添加两个磁盘,当将磁盘2 和磁盘3 添加进来后,“添加”按钮就 呈灰色,表示不能再添加磁盘,并且两块磁盘容量必须相同。最后创建好的镜像卷P 容量 为1GB,如图3.28 所示,也就是说磁盘空间利用率为50%。 Windows Server 2012 系统管理与网络服务配置 64 图 3.27 图 3.28 3.3.5 RAID-5 卷 所谓RAID-5 卷,就是指含有奇偶校验值的带区卷,Windows Server 2012 为卷集中的 每个磁盘添加一个奇偶校验值,这样在确保了带区卷优越性能的同时,还提供了容错性。 RAID-5 卷至少包含3 块磁盘,最多32 块,阵列中任意一块磁盘失败时,都可以由另两块 磁盘中的信息做运算,并将失败的磁盘中的数据恢复。创建时也要求每块磁盘分配的容量 相同。如果每块磁盘分配2GB,最后由三块磁盘创建好的RAID-5 卷Q 容量为4GB,如 图3.29 所示,也就是说磁盘空间利用率为2/3(若是磁盘数量为n,则磁盘空间利用率为 (n-1)/n)。 第 章 磁盘管理 65 3 图 3.29 RAID-5 卷的修复:为了验证RAID-5 卷的容错性,下面来做一个模拟实验。将磁盘3 移除,模拟磁盘损坏,这时状态为失败的重复,如图3.30 所示。 图 3.30 再添加磁盘3,然后联机、初始化并转换为动态磁盘,如图3.31 所示。 图 3.31 Windows Server 2012 系统管理与网络服务配置 66 在磁盘1 或磁盘2 的Q 卷处右击,在弹出的快捷菜单中选择“修复卷”选项,然后选 择磁盘3,单击“确定”按钮,如图3.32 所示。 图 3.32 重新同步后,如图3.33 所示,显示卷Q 的状态为“状态良好”说明已经修复成功。 图 3.33 3.4 磁盘配额的设置 磁盘配额是计算机中指定磁盘的存储限制,管理员可以为用户所能使用的磁盘空间进 行配额限制,可以限制指定账户能够使用的磁盘空间,这样可以避免因某个用户的过度使 用磁盘空间造成其他用户无法正常工作,甚至影响系统运行。只要用 NTFS 文件系统将卷 格式化,就可以在本地卷、网络卷以及可移动驱动器上启动配额。另外,网络卷必须从卷 的根目录中得到共享,可移动驱动器也必须是共享的。 启动磁盘配额时,可以设置两个值:磁盘配额限制和磁盘配额警告级别。例如,可 以把用户的磁盘配额限制设为500MB,并把磁盘配额警告级别设为450MB。在这种情况 第 章 磁盘管理 67 3 下,用户可在卷上存储不超过500MB 的文件。如果用户在卷上存储的文件超过450MB, 则可把磁盘配额系统配置成记录系统事件。只有 Administrators 组的成员才能管理卷上的 配额。 可以指定用户能超过其配额限制。如果不想拒绝用户对卷的访问但想跟踪每个用户的 磁盘空间使用情况,启用配额而且不限制磁盘空间的使用是非常有用的。也可指定不管用 户超过配额警告级别还是超过配额限制时是否要记录事件。 例如可以对卷G 进行配额设置。方法是在资源管理器中进入卷G,右击,选择“属性” 下的“配额”。如图3.34 所示,目前未配置磁盘配额。 图 3.34 若要配置磁盘配额,则选择“启用配额管理”,并选择是否拒绝为超过配额的用户分 配空间,并设置限制的空间大小和配额警告级别。为了验证配额管理的效果,我们将磁盘 空间限制设置为10MB,然后分别复制两个文件,一个不超过这个限额,一个超过限额以 作对比,如图3.35 所示。 如果要为特定的用户设置不同的配额项,可以在上面的配置窗口中,进入“配额项” 设置,选择“配额”菜单下的“新建配额项”,然后选择用户userA,并设置其配额,如 图3.36 所示。 如果虚拟机上没安装VMware Tools,则不能把文件复制到虚拟机。VMware Tools 是虚 拟机VMware Workstation 自带的一款工具,它的作用之一就是使用户可以从物理主机直接往 虚拟机里面拖放文件。如果不安装它,我们是无法进行虚拟机和物理机之间的文件传输的, Windows Server 2012 系统管理与网络服务配置 68 图 3.35 图 3.36 当然它的功效不止于此,平时我们操作虚拟机的时候,在物理机和虚拟机之间必须使用 Ctrl 键切换,安装之后我们就不必使用键盘切换,直接便可退出,使得虚拟机真正成为计 算机的一部分。这里先介绍VMware Tools 的安装过程。 第 章 磁盘管理 69 3 单击“虚拟机”下的“安装VMware Tools”向导,按提示安装。选择“运行setup64.exe” 运行安装向导进行安装,如图3.37 所示。 可以选择典型安装,也可以根据情况选择其他两种安装方式,如图3.38 所示。 图 3.37 图 3.38 单击“下一步”按钮,根据安装向导完成安装,如图3.39 所示。 图 3.39 安装完成后重新启动系统生效,如图3.40 所示。 图 3.40 Windows Server 2012 系统管理与网络服务配置 70 验证:现在分别用userA 用户和另一普通用户mary 登录系统。userA 用户登录后,顺 利将一大于10MB 的文件存入G 卷,而mary 用户在复制文件时,则显示卷上空间不足, 不能复制,如图3.41 所示。 图 3.41 3.5 本 章 小 结 本章主要学习了磁盘类型、基本磁盘管理和动态磁盘管理。需要注意几种动态磁盘的 类型、特征和创建方法。其中读取速度最快的是带区卷,有容错功能的是镜像卷和RAID-5 卷,而镜像卷的磁盘空间利用率为50%,RAID-5 卷至少要三块磁盘才能创建。在配置磁盘 配额时,注意可以设置通用的配额,也可以针对某些用户和组专门设置不同的配额。 习 题 3 一、填空题 1.磁盘的两种类型是:一种是 ,另一种磁盘类型是 。 2.一个基本磁盘MBR 上最多有 个分区。 3.要启用磁盘配额管理,必须使用 文件系统。 4.基本磁盘的磁盘分为主分区和 分区。 二、简答题 1.磁盘分为哪两种分区样式?其含义分别是什么? 2.简述RAID-5 卷的特点。 3.带区卷和跨区卷的区别是什么? 4.简述磁盘配额的设置过程。